Estimation of age using pulp/tooth area ratio using orthopantomographs and intra-oral periapical radiographs
Abstract
Teeth are crucial for assessing age, as they remain intact even after death in forensic dentistry. Various regression models, such as polynomial regression, new robust regression equations, multiple linear regression models and partial least squares linear regression, are used to determine age. The pulp/tooth area ratio (AR) of maxillary canines is a direct link between age and the subject's age, making multiple regressions the most reliable method. Teeth hardness and invariant changes in their structure also strengthen teeth's applicability in estimating age. These statistical methods are suitable for both forensic and clinical applications, making them suitable for both forensic and clinical applications.
